What is a Ruby On Rails Developer Contract job?

A Ruby on Rails Developer Contract job is a temporary role where a developer is hired to build, maintain, or improve applications using the Ruby on Rails framework. These contracts can range from a few months to a year or more, depending on the project's scope. Contractors typically work on web applications, backend systems, or API development. They may be hired by startups, agencies, or larger companies looking for specialized expertise without committing to a full-time role.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Ruby On Rails Developer Contract position,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Ruby On Rails Developer Contract, you need strong proficiency in Ruby, Rails framework, RESTful APIs, and SQL databases, typically demonstrated through professional experience or relevant computer science education. Familiarity with version control systems like Git, testing frameworks (such as RSpec), and deployment tools is essential, while certifications or open-source contributions can be advantageous. Excellent problem-solving skills, adaptability, and effective communication are crucial soft skills for collaborating with distributed teams and delivering client-focused solutions. These abilities are vital to ensure robust, maintainable code and successful project outcomes within contract-based, time-sensitive work environments.

What are the typical day-to-day responsibilities for a contract Ruby On Rails Developer?

As a contract Ruby On Rails Developer, your daily tasks usually include developing and maintaining web applications, writing clean backend code, integrating third-party services, and troubleshooting technical issues as they arise. You'll often participate in virtual standups or meetings with cross-functional teams, collaborate on feature planning, and provide input on best practices for code quality and application architecture. Additionally, you may be responsible for writing tests, updating documentation, and assisting with direct deployments depending on the team's workflow. As an Engineer-Power Innovation, youwill manage end-to-end roadway permitting and access approvals for fast-paced power innovation projects, ensuring compliance with local, state, and railroad requirements. You will developpermittingand access strategies; coordinate across engineering, environmental, construction management, legal, and external consultants; negotiate Road Use Management Agreements (RUMAs), Rights of Entry (ROEs), and Railroad Crossing Agreements; and trackpermitconditions through construction closeout and roadway restoration. You will serve as a technical advisor on traffic engineering, maintenance of traffic (MOT), haul routes, roadway and bridge restrictions, and railroad engineering standards, supporting safe execution, stakeholder alignment, andcosteffectiverestoration outcomes. In senior roles, you will lead strategy, provide technical leadership, and manage complex negotiations, while in mid-level roles, you will execute drafting, submittals, tracking, field coordination, and compliancefollowthrough.

About Pittsburgh

Pittsburgh is a city full of adventure. If you love a good ball game or the great outdoors such as visiting Point State Park in Pittsburgh's "Golden Triangle" to see the Allegheny River, Monongahela River, and Ohio River converge, then Pittsburgh has you covered! The city is also known for its "Only in Pittsburgh" experiences and its unique and vibrant 90 neighborhoods that create the perfect places to live, hang out and explore.

Also, Pittsburgh is a convenient, affordable place to live and work-with a cost of living 7% lower than the national average.

The Steel City's accent is a thing to behold, and you'll find people living in Pittsburgh and Western Pennsylvania speaking Pittsburghese. You may hear the term "yinzer," which is the equivalent to the word "y'all" and used to address two or more people as a second-person plural pronoun. If you're moving to the 'Burgh, learning Pittsburghese will help!
